The Employment Equity Regulations, 2025 came into effect on 15 April 2025, repealing and replacing the 2014 Regulations. Also in effect from 15 April 2025 is the Determination on Sectoral Numerical Targets which applies to 18 national economic sectors. Employment law earnings threshold increase from 1 April 2025
This blog was co-authored by Caroline Cotton, Candidate Attorney.
On 7 March 2025 the Minister of Employment and Labour announced an increase in the annual earnings threshold from R254 371,67 to R261 748,45. The increase is in effect from 1 April 2025.

Commencement of new Labour Court and Labour Appeal Court rules
New Labour Court and Labour Appeal Court rules come into operation on 17 July 2024. The new rules will replace the existing rules as well as the Practice Manual of the Labour Court.
